IT managers vs Midwifery nurses Salary (2025)
How do IT managers and Midwifery nurses sal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.
IT managers earns £18,743 more per year (50% higher)
Detailed Comparison
| Metric | IT managers | Midwifery nurses |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Annual | £56,234 | £37,491 | +£18,743 |
| Mean Annual | £60,038 | £38,707 | +£21,331 |
| Monthly | £4,686 | £3,124 | +£1,562 |
| Weekly | £1,081 | £721 | +£360 |
| Hourly | £27.04 | £18.02 | +£9.02 |
Salary Range Comparison
| Percentile | IT managers | Midwifery nurses |
|---|---|---|
| 10th (Entry) | £33,025 | £19,766 |
| 25th | £43,309 | £29,430 |
| 50th (Median) | £56,234 | £37,491 |
| 75th | £72,165 | £48,585 |
